FORWARD COUNSELING CARE | HOYLETON YOUTH AND FAMILY SERVICES

Offers intervention services (including art therapy, CBT, DBT skills, play therapy, TF-CBT, psychotherapy, and other evidence-based interventions) are available to treat the following behavioral health issues:

- Trauma and PTSD.
- Anxiety, depression, and mood disorders.
- Conduct problems, ADHD, and behavioral issues.
- Grief/bereavement.
- Relationship and social issues.

Spanish-speaking therapy services available.
